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/flutter/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何编写DB2命令_Db2 - Fatal编程技术网

如何编写DB2命令

如何编写DB2命令,db2,Db2,在哪里编写DB2命令。例如,我想删除表中的所有行。我打开db2cmd并粘贴命令,但它不起作用。我是否需要转到db2cmd中的特定路径才能使命令工作 另外,db2命令编辑器中的命令也不起作用。以下是截图: 谢谢您必须首先使用命令连接到DB2数据库 阅读完SQL CONNECT页面后,请阅读整个IBM DB2手册。您可以从命令行执行类似的操作(在Windowd中称为db2cmd的db2clp) 或者就是这个,如果你知道表名的话 db2 truncate table db2admin.prisiju

在哪里编写DB2命令。例如,我想删除表中的所有行。我打开db2cmd并粘贴命令,但它不起作用。我是否需要转到db2cmd中的特定路径才能使命令工作

另外,db2命令编辑器中的命令也不起作用。以下是截图:


谢谢

您必须首先使用命令连接到DB2数据库


阅读完SQL CONNECT页面后,请阅读整个IBM DB2手册。

您可以从命令行执行类似的操作(在Windowd中称为db2cmd的db2clp)

或者就是这个,如果你知道表名的话

db2 truncate table db2admin.prisijungihai2 immediate
使用此命令,并且如果您对表拥有足够的权限,则可以删除数据库中的任何行

这是一个你一直在等待的快速答案


顺便说一句,Control center已被弃用,现在您应该使用IBM Data Studio。

谢谢,我没有时间阅读整个手册。我只需要删除表中的所有行。显然,没有命令窗口是不可能的。无法连接,可能问题是控制中心是DB2COPY2,db2cmd是DB2COPY1,就像这里:我如何将db2cmd更改为DB2COPY2?我们不是在填鸭式地向您提供DB2答案。我不是要用勺子喂我。我只是问了一个简单的问题,为什么我不能写命令。我连接到数据库,我在控制中心使用了connect函数。建议读取任何DB2命令的输出。它清楚地表明“没有与数据库的连接”
db2 truncate table db2admin.prisijungihai2 immediate